Stars
BullFrog AI Holdings, Inc. does not disclose a market-leading product with high share in 2025, and its product set remains narrow and early stage. With no clear sales leader or scale signal, there is no visible BCG Star in the portfolio. That usually means the company is still building product-market fit, not compounding share from an established winner.
bfLEAP is Bullfrog AI Holdings, Inc.'s core AI and machine-learning platform, and it carries clear strategic value because it anchors the product set. Public filings and company updates show it is still early-stage: the platform is important, but it has not yet shown category-leading scale or durable commercial pull. That makes bfLEAP a growth asset, not a proven Star.
Founded in 2017, BullFrog AI Holdings, Inc. is still development focused, so it does not fit a classic BCG Star. Early-stage firms usually need strong, proven adoption and rising cash generation, and BullFrog AI still looks earlier in that curve. In BCG terms, it fits a Question Mark more than a Star.
Two university licenses
BullFrog AI Holdings, Inc. has 2 university licenses, from George Washington University and Johns Hopkins University. They are promising pre-commercial IP assets, but they still lack the market share and revenue base needed for Star status in the BCG Matrix.

Cash Cows
BullFrog AI Holdings, Inc. does not disclose any marketed drug sales, so it has no mature, steady revenue base to fit a cash cow. In 2025, BullFrog AI reported no product sales, and its business remained centered on AI drug discovery, not a commercial drug portfolio. Without high market share and recurring sales, this BCG box does not apply.
Bullfrog AI Holdings, Inc. does not show a recurring royalty stream in its public filings, so this does not fit a cash cow profile. Its licensed assets are still in development, which means cash inflow is not yet steady. In BCG terms, there is no clear royalty engine to harvest.
bfLEAP is a platform, but BullFrog AI Holdings, Inc. has not disclosed a scaled subscription base or ARR in its latest filings, so this is not yet a cash cow. Cash cows usually show predictable, high-margin renewals, and BullFrog AI has not shown that recurring revenue profile yet. With no disclosed large recurring customer base, cash flow stays early-stage and uneven.
No profit center disclosed
No profit center is disclosed, and BullFrog AI still looks investment-led, not cash-generative. In FY2025, that profile is inconsistent with a cash cow because cash cows should fund growth, not absorb it. SEC filings point to continued losses and cash burn, so this unit does not fit the BCG cash cow box.

Question Marks
bfLEAP is BullFrog AI Holdings, Inc.'s core proprietary platform, and it fits the Question Mark box because it targets the fast-growing AI drug discovery market but BullFrog AI has not shown high market share. The AI drug discovery market was valued at about USD 1.8 billion in 2023 and is projected to grow at over 30% CAGR through 2030, so the upside is real. Still, without scale or clear share gains, bfLEAP needs heavy investment to prove traction.
GWU’s siRNA Beta2-spectrin license is a Question Mark for Bullfrog AI Holdings, Inc. because it targets big markets but has little commercial share today. HCC causes about 865,000 new cases a year, obesity affects over 1 billion people, and NAFLD/NASH may impact roughly 25% to 30% of adults, but this asset is still early and unproven. That means the upside is large, yet current revenue and market penetration are likely near zero.
JHU mebendazole formulation is a Question Mark for Bullfrog AI Holdings, Inc. because the Johns Hopkins University license targets cancers and neoplastic diseases, but the asset is still early and has not shown market leadership. Oncology remains a large growth pool, with global cancer spending measured in the hundreds of billions of dollars, but this program has no disclosed commercial revenue yet. The fit is high-upside, but the current stage is still a development bet, not a proven cash driver.
